Bit by the painting bug

On the heels of last weeks melta gunner I decided to finish off my remaining jump packers. I had four regulars to use as another squad (with soon to be finished add-in Sarge) or as extra bodies for my existing three squads. 




I really love the Sanguinary Angelius bolt gun. It makes a nice addition to assault troops.

The same goes for the Blood Angel box. It has so many great assault army bits. I know I keep saying it and I'll continue to sing the praises of this kit. It is so a must have for building a close combat Marine army. 
I love the running legs and swept back sword arm, like he just cut something down and is running and gunning now.

I had scored a set of metal Raptor jump packs from E-Bay. I think they look so much better than the standard Marine plastic version. I'm glad I got them and like how they turned out in the squad.

I filed down the feathery wing on this chainsword hilt and tried to make it look like a Night Lord bat wing. I'm not unhappy with the final result. It works better from gaming distance than from close up.
